The Delicious Evolution: Uncovering the Fascinating History of Quiche

Quiche, a dish that has become synonymous with sophistication and elegance, has a long and fascinating history that dates back centuries. Its evolution from a simple peasant dish to a beloved delicacy is a testament to the ingenuity and creativity of French cuisine.

Quiche originated in the Lorraine region of France, where it was known as quiche Lorraine. The traditional recipe consisted of a pastry crust filled with a savory custard made of eggs, cream, and various ingredients such as cheese, vegetables, and meats. Originally a humble dish enjoyed by farmers and laborers, quiche Lorraine eventually gained popularity among the French aristocracy.

Over the years, quiche has undergone various transformations and adaptations, with different regions of France developing their own unique versions of the dish. Today, quiche is enjoyed worldwide and is a staple of brunch menus and elegant dinner parties.
